Enmity, and between thine and her seed;180
Her seed shall bruise thy head, thou bruise his heel."
So spake this oracle, then verified
When Jesus, son of Mary, second Eve,
Saw Satan fall like lightning down from heaven,
Prince of the air; then, rising from his grave,
Spoiled Principalities and Powers, triumphed
In open shew, and, with ascension bright,
Captivity led captive through the air,
The realm itself of Satan, long usurped,
Whom he shall tread at last under our feet;190
Even he who now foretold his fatal bruise,
And to the Woman thus his sentence turned:
"Thy sorrow I will greatly multiply
By thy conception; children thou shalt bring
In sorrow forth; and to thy husband's will
Thine shall submit; he over thee shall rule."
On Adam last thus judgment he pronounced:
"Because thou hast hearkened to the voice of thy wife,
And eaten of the tree, concerning which199
I charged thee, saying, Thou shalt not eat thereof,
Cursed is the ground for thy sake; thou in sorrow
Shalt eat thereof all the days of thy life;
Thorns also and thistles it shall bring thee forth,
Unbid; and thou shalt eat the herb of the field;
In the sweat of thy face shalt then eat bread,
